Strong's #8513 - תְּלָאָה
- Brown-Driver-Briggs
- Strong
1) toil, hardship, distress, weariness

1258) el (לה LH) AC: ? CO: ? AB: Weary: To be weary from a non productive effort. To be without results. Related to al.
D) eal (לאה LAH) AC: Weary CO: ? AB: Trouble
V) eal (לאה LAH) - Weary: KJV (19): (vf: Paal, Niphal, Hiphil) weary, grieve, faint, loath - Strongs: H3811 (לָאָה)
if1) ealt (תלאה TLAH) - Trouble: What brings about weariness. KJV (4): travail, trouble - Strongs: H8513 (תְּלָאָה)
aif1) ealtm (מתלאה MTLAH) - Weariness: KJV (1): weariness, travail, trouble - Strongs: H4972 (מַתְּלָאָה)
H) eel (להה LHH) AC: Weary CO: ? AB: ?
V) eel (להה LHH) - Weary: KJV (2): (vf: Paal) faint, mad - Strongs: H3856 (לָהַה)

תְּלָאָה f. (from the root לָאָה, like תְּעָלָה from the root עָלָה, for תַּלְאָוָה, תַּלְאָאָה, see Lehrg. p. 502), labour, toil, weariness, Exodus 18:8; Numbers 20:14; Nehemiah 9:32.
